これまで述べたことから明らかなように、蒸気は、加熱等に使用されてその潜熱を失った後は相変化して復水になりますが、その時点の温度は蒸気と同じです。この特性を持つ潜熱は、一定温度で安定した加熱処理を必要とするプロセスや殺菌等において極めて有効なエネルギーとなります。蒸気がエネルギーの運び手として優れている理由は、非常に大きな潜熱を保有できる、ありふれた物質だからです。
